The importance of temporary road signs in urban areas
In the bustling environment of urban areas, the need for effective traffic management is paramount. Temporary road signs play a crucial role in guiding drivers, pedestrians, and cyclists through areas where regular traffic patterns are disrupted. These signs are essential tools for ensuring safety and efficiency in urban traffic management.
The Role of Temporary Road Signs in Urban Traffic Management
Safety is the primary concern in any traffic management strategy. Temporary road signs are vital in alerting road users to changes in traffic conditions, such as roadworks, detours, or lane closures. By providing clear and timely information, these signs help prevent accidents and ensure the safety of both road users and workers.
Temporary road signs are instrumental in maintaining smooth traffic flow in urban areas. They guide drivers through alternative routes, reducing congestion and minimizing delays. Effective placement and visibility of these signs ensure that traffic moves efficiently, even in the face of disruptions.
Compliance with traffic regulations is a critical aspect of urban traffic management. Temporary road signs must adhere to local and national standards to ensure consistency and reliability. This compliance not only enhances safety but also helps avoid legal issues for construction companies, event organizers, and other entities responsible for traffic management.
Applications of Temporary Road Signs
Construction projects in urban areas often require temporary road signs to manage traffic around the site. These signs inform drivers of changes in road conditions, such as lane closures or detours, and ensure the safety of both workers and the public.
Events in urban areas, such as marathons, parades, or festivals, necessitate the use of temporary road signs to manage the influx of traffic and pedestrians. These signs help direct attendees to parking areas, entry points, and exits, ensuring a smooth and safe experience for all involved.
Film production teams often require temporary road signs to manage traffic around shooting locations. These signs help minimize disruptions to local traffic and ensure the safety of both the crew and the public.
Challenges and Considerations
Urban areas are characterized by high density and limited space, which can pose challenges for the placement of temporary road signs. It is crucial to strategically position these signs to maximize visibility and effectiveness without obstructing pedestrian pathways or other essential infrastructure.
Ensuring that temporary road signs are visible and easily understood is essential for their effectiveness. This involves using clear and concise messaging, appropriate colors, and reflective materials to enhance visibility in various lighting conditions.
Effective traffic management in urban areas requires coordination with local authorities. This ensures that temporary road signs are placed in compliance with regulations and that any necessary permits are obtained. Collaboration with authorities also facilitates the smooth implementation of traffic management plans.
